Crestline - The California Highway Patrol has closed all mountain roadways, including Highway 18, 330, 138, and 173, to non-residents. Any residents returning to the mountains will be required to show proof-of-residency such as a drivers license, utility bill, or other identifying document. An evacuation center has been established at the Jerry Lewis Center in Highland for all evacuees.

Air command has begun discussing using the DC-10 tanker to make high altitude drops from about 300 feet above the targets.
